About the College
University of Phoenix has grown so much since it was first started in 1976 that it has become one of the favorites to attend by on campus or online. Every year the enrolment grows from more than the last year. With their convenient locations and online learning it is dedicated to the working families and students. They work around you; you do not work around them. If you have to work or have family obligations then they have classes for you to take when you have the time. They have highly qualified teachers with life experience besides an excellent education themselves.
About the campus
The campus has many things to offer its students. Some of the benefits are a student store where you can buy everything from books to gifts to show your school off. They do not offer on campus housing or meals but they do have a realtor that has apartments and houses that have been used by students for many years. They also have a list of cafes and restaurants close by the campus with in a bus ride away. Nice days you and your friends can walk. Even at night because they have campus security to know your safe while being out at night.
About the courses
Students and families that want to earn their degree can take courses on their schedule even if it is one class at a time. Master’s degrees can only take two to three years to earn. You can choose between the undergraduate and the graduate level at the Bakersfield Central Valley Campus. So you can decide if on campus education is for you or if your schedule is so hectic you need online courses. No matter what you choose check and see what is available to you because online courses and different campus locations have different schedules.

College Type: 4-year, Private for-profit

Offering: Less than one year certificate, Associate's degree, Bachelor's degree, Postbaccalaureate certificate, Master's degree

Campus Setting: City, Large

Campus Housing Available: No

Student Population: 2000, 86% undergraduates
